From: Physical Interaction Is Required in Social Buffering Induced by a Familiar Conspecific

Tone cue presentation (CS+) induced freezing response of mice effectively.
During presentation, subjects in social group (S) showed significant lower freezing percentage than odor+ group (O+) and odor− group (O−). But there was no difference between three groups without tone cue (CS−). *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01, ***p < 0.001, &0.05 < p < 0.1.
